Commercials

How We Price, And Why

Four commitments that apply to every engagement regardless of size.

Fixed fee, not day rate

You get a number before work starts. If we scoped it badly, that is our problem to absorb, not yours.

Phased commitment

Longer builds are split into phases with a decision point at each boundary. You can stop at any of them.

No lock-in

Source, infrastructure, and documentation transfer at handover. Nothing we build needs us to keep running.

No commission

We take no referral fee from any vendor, model provider, or platform we recommend.
